  5. Size

    Hi, I'm thinking of changing the GPU on one of my desktop PCs. I don't have to worry about power because I recently (Just a couple hours ago) installed a 700W PSU with 2x PCI-E connectors, 6 x SATA Connector, 4 + 4 pin sever CPU connector, and a 20+4 pin main connector. You're probably thinking "oh, just go ahead and buy a GTX 295 then". Problem is, most high end cards are complete fat asses, even old cards like the 8800. I opened up my case again and did some measurements, right now on my PC I have a 4650 1GB, it's about 7.5 inches (19cm)long and I have about 4-5 inches (10-13cm) of space between the end of the card and the hard drive bay. Question is. What's the best card (max $200) that I can place in my tower case that can actually fit?
